Commit 90fe7ec
committed
Enhance lesson management in GitHub Sync plugin
- Added support for lesson pages: created, updated, and removed counts.
- Implemented processing of lesson directories and their YAML files.
- Updated the database schema to include an 'itemid' field in the mapping table.
- Introduced new language strings for lesson page operations.
- Updated versioning to 0.7.0 and adjusted upgrade scripts for database changes.1 parent 143f985 commit 90fe7ec
File tree
6 files changed
+1037
-6
lines changed- classes/sync
- db
- lang/en
6 files changed
+1037
-6
lines changed
0 commit comments